Course Highlights
Miccosukee Golf Course impresses with a challenging water-laden layout, consistently excellent course conditions, and true-rolling greens that rival top South Florida courses. A brand-new clubhouse, expansive driving range with Trackman bays, and genuinely friendly staff deliver strong value for the experience.

Best value in town.

Starting out with the one minor complaint. It seems they work so hard to keep the greens in outstanding shape, they neglect the fairways a little. A few areas are spotty, but playable.

All three nines at this course are challenging and any two makes for a great round. The Dolphin/Marlin combo is the best in my opinion as the Barracuda is a little tricky, i.e., forced layups and hidden water hazards.

As I mentioned, the greens are awesome and have some tricky breaks. Sand traps are in good shape and the tee boxes are good as well. Great value for the money.

Must play for those who like challenges

The greens for all 3-courses are 4.5 stars. The fairways are 3 stars. The tee boxes are 3.5 stars. All 3-courses are similar with plenty of large size (I mean larger than typical ones) sand bunkers surrounding each hole. Water is everywhere; alongside fairways and surrounding every hole. You have to force yourself to be straight and precise; otherwise, you would end up in water or sand bunkers. The greens are excellent and have enough undulations to make you feel puzzling. Needless to say, this course has plenty of stuff to test your IQs, EQs, and golf skills.
